Table 7.
Gene ontology and enrichment for the effects of region, populations, host cacti on gene expression differences in female Drosophila mojavensis in this study. All functional clustering was based on genes with FDR p < .01 for each treatment effect
| Comparison | No. genes (No. annotated) | GO term | Enrich score |
|---|---|---|---|
| 1. Region | 1432 (954) | 1. Electron carrier activity, heme binding, tetrapyrrole binding, P‐450 gene activity | 6.8**** |
| 2. Endopeptidase inhibitor activity | 2.9** | ||
| 3. tRNA processing | 1.9* | ||
| 4. tRNA aminoacylation | 1.7* | ||
| Mainland > Baja California | 687 (472) | 1. Electron carrier activity, heme binding, tetrapyrrole binding, P‐450 gene activity | 3.2*** |
| 2. tRNA processing | 2.1** | ||
| 3. Cofactor binding | 1.3* | ||
| Baja California > Mainland | 745 (482) | 1. Endopeptidase inhibitor activity | 4.6**** |
| 2. Secondary metabolites biosynthesis, transport, and catabolism, electron carrier activity, heme binding, tetrapyrrole binding | 2.8** | ||
| 3. Exopeptidase activity | 2.0** | ||
| 2. Population | 745 (200) | 1. Peptidase, proteolysis | 7.3**** |
| 2. Secondary metabolites biosynthesis, transport, and catabolism, electron carrier | 2.5** | ||
| 3. tRNA processing | 3.1*** | ||
| 4. Endopeptidase inhibitor activity | 3.0*** | ||
| 5. Nonglucose carbohydrate catabolism | 2.6** | ||
| 3. Baja California | 153 (83) | ||
| Punta Prieta > San Quintin | 72 (39) | 1. Sensory perception | 2.5** |
| 2. Muscle protein | 1.9* | ||
| San Quintin > Punta Prieta | 81 (44) | 1. Calcium ion binding, EGF‐like | 2.1** |
| 2. P‐450 gene activity, oxidoreductase | 1.9* | ||
| 4. Mainland (Arizona vs. Sonora)a | 587 (373) | ||
| Organ Pipe NM > Punta Onah | 204 (133) | 1. Ribosome biogenesis | 2.8** |
| 2. RNA splicing | 2.2** | ||
| 3. Methyltransferase | 2.0** | ||
| 4. Hydro‐lyase activity | 1.5* | ||
| 5. Helicase activity | 1.5* | ||
| Punta Onah > Organ Pipe NM | 383 (240) | 1. EGF‐like region | 4.2*** |
| 2. Extracellular glycosylation, signal peptide | 2.9** | ||
| 3. Extracellular matrix | 2.8** | ||
| 4. Plasma membrane receptor | 2.7** | ||
| 5. Antimicrobial response | 2.7** | ||
| 5. Host cactus | 2457 (1816) | ||
| Agria > Organ pipe | 2094 (1524) | 1. Peptidase, proteolysis | 13.6**** |
| 2. Secondary metabolites biosynthesis, transport, and catabolism, electron carrier activity, heme binding, tetrapyrrole binding | 7.2**** | ||
| 3. ATP, cellular respiration, electron transport | 4.6**** | ||
| 4. Exopeptidase activity | 3.7*** | ||
| 5. Endopeptidase inhibitor activity | 3.7*** | ||
| 6. Cytochrome‐c oxidase activity | 3.6*** | ||
| 7. NADH dehydrogenase activity | 3.2*** | ||
| 8. Extracellular matrix | 2.6** | ||
| 9. Mitochondrial membrane | 2.6** | ||
| 10. TCA cycle | 2.4** | ||
| Organ pipe > Agria | 363 (292) | 1. DNA repair | 9.0**** |
| 2. DNA replication | 8.9**** | ||
| 3. Nucleosome, chromatin assembly | 8.5**** | ||
| 4. ATP binding | 5.0**** | ||
| 5. Mitosis | 2.5** |
*p < .05, **p < .01, ***p < .001, ****p < .0001.
aOrgan Pipe National Monument, Arizona and Punta Onah, Sonora, Mexico.
